About The Bourne Academy

The Bourne Academy sits within the Bournemouth, Christchurch and Poole local authority, a secondary school that ranks 19th out of 21 similar schools in the area when measured by Progress 8. That places it in the bottom half of local state secondaries, well behind the top-performing peers nearby: Glenmoor Academy, The Bournemouth and Poole College, and Poole Grammar School. The nearest school rated Outstanding by Ofsted is Winton Academy, just 1.2 kilometres away. The Bourne Academy itself holds a Good rating from its most recent graded inspection in 2019, and an ungraded visit in February 2025 confirmed that standards are being maintained. It is a mixed, non-religious state school for pupils aged 11 to 18, with a capacity of 1,050 and currently 946 pupils on roll. The proportion of pupils eligible for free school meals stands at 36.8%, well above the national average, giving a clear sense of the community it serves.
